Posts - Bill - S 138 VA Home Loan Awareness Act of 2025
senate 01/16/2025 - 119th Congress
We are introducing the VA Home Loan Awareness Act of 2025 to ensure that veterans are informed about their eligibility for VA home loan programs by requiring a clear disclaimer on the Uniform Residential Loan Application. This initiative aims to enhance awareness and access to financial benefits for those who have served in the military.
